Raptee appoints former Ather and Ola Electric veteran C Suresh as Head of Operations
C Suresh has 25 years of experience, working with leading brands of which the last 7 years have been in the EV sector as part of the founding team at Ather and Ola.
EV Motorcycle startup Raptee has appointed former Ola and Ather veteran C Suresh as Head of Operations. He will be heading Operations including manufacturing, quality, sourcing and supply chain.
One of the pivotal roles will be to plan and roll out the products in the near future. Suresh will focus on constructing additional facilities to cater to the projected demand for Raptee Motorcycle.
Suresh, comes with over 25 years of experience, has worked with major auto brands like TVS Motors, Royal Enfield, Mahindra, Ather, and Ola Electric. He comes with the experience of handling more than 13 new product launches in his career.
Suresh has managed supplier relationships across India and international markets, including Vietnam, China, Taiwan, and Europe, overseeing a vast network of over 200 suppliers. His role in establishing the new plants at Ather and Ola Future Factory underscores his commitment to innovation, quality and cutting-edge manufacturing, the press release further noted.
